Warning Signs of a Burst Pipe:

  • Sudden drop in water pressure
  • Unusual water sounds (rushing or whistling)
  • Wet spots on walls, floors, or ceilings
  • Unexplained increase in water bills
  • Water discoloration or unusual odors
  • Visible water pooling or flooding

Burst Pipe Prevention Tips

  • Insulate exposed pipes during cold weather
  • Keep your home heated during freezing temperatures
  • Allow faucets to drip during extreme cold
  • Schedule regular plumbing inspections
  • Know where your main water shut-off valve is located
